The Genesis and Evolution of Digital Asset Tokenization

Tokenization involves converting rights to an asset into a digital token on a blockchain, enabling fractional ownership, liquidity enhancement, and global accessibility. From real estate and art to equities and commodities, industries are exploring tokenization as a means to unlock previously illiquid markets and democratize investment opportunities.

Early pioneers like tZero and platforms such as Polymath laid the groundwork for regulated issuance of security tokens. However, as the industry matured, the need for more sophisticated, user-friendly, and compliant platforms became evident. This led to the emergence of providers that combine technological innovation with legal and regulatory expertise.

Technological and Regulatory Challenges

ChallengeImpactExample
Regulatory UncertaintyDiffering legal frameworks complicate cross-border issuancesEuropean vs. US security token laws
Technological ScalabilityLimited transaction throughput on certain blockchainsEthereum network congestion affecting token transfers
Security and Fraud PreventionEnsuring asset and investor protectionSmart contract vulnerabilities during issuance

Overcoming these hurdles requires robust platforms that integrate compliance protocols, scalable blockchain infrastructure, and advanced security measures. The industry is witnessing a proliferation of specialized solutions that prioritize these aspects, with some platforms offering comprehensive ecosystems for issuers and investors alike.

Industry Insights and Future Outlook

According to recent reports from Boston Consulting Group and Deloitte, blockchain-based asset tokenization could unlock up to $16 trillion in assets globally by 2030. However, realizing this potential depends heavily on the development and deployment of credible, secure, and regulations-aware platforms.

Moreover, decentralized finance (DeFi) and non-fungible tokens (NFTs) are further expanding the scope, emphasizing the need for platforms that can handle a broad spectrum of assets while maintaining rigorous compliance standards.
